Most common CDCR abbreviation full forms updated in March 2024 WebAug 3, 2024 · These contractors provide a variety of services — for 180 days with a possible extension of up to a year — to those leaving prison. One of these STOP providers is New Life Community Services of Santa Cruz, Calif. WebThe Division of Rehabilitative Programs (DRP) provides comprehensive post-release rehabilitative programs and services located in communities throughout the State of California. WebIn July 2024, CDCR announced an additional series of release actions in an effort to further decompress the population to maximize space for physical distancing, and isolation/quarantine efforts. The expedited releases of eligible individuals with 180 days or less remaining on their sentences began on a rolling basis in July.
